Warning Signs You Need Leaking Pipe Water Removal
Ignoring the warning signs of a leaky pipe can lead to catastrophic consequences.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ent further damage. Here are some common warning signs you should look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ell in your home can be a sign of a leaky pipe. These odors are often caused by mold and mildew growth, which can be hazardous to your health. If you notice a musty smell that persists even after cleaning, it’s essential to investigate further.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a leaky pipe. These stains can be caused by water seeping through the walls or ceiling, and if left unchecked, can lead to further damage. Look for stains that are discolored, warped, or sagging.
Soggy Carpet or Flooring
Soggy carpet or flooring can be a sign of a leaky pipe. If you notice your carpet or flooring is consistently damp or wet, it’s essential to investigate further. This can be caused by a leaky pipe, and if left unchecked, can lead to further damage.
Increased Water Bills
Increased water bills can be a sign of a leaky pipe. If you notice your water bills are higher than usual, it may be a sign that you have a leaky pipe. This can be caused by a slow leak that’s wasting water and driving up your bills.
Warm or Cold Spots on Your Floor
Warm or cold spots on your floor can be a sign of a leaky pipe. If you notice areas of your floor that are consistently warmer or colder than the rest of the room, it may be a sign of a leaky pipe. This can be caused by water seeping through the floor and warming or cooling the surrounding area.

Leaking Pipe Water Removal Cost in Centerville, GA
The cost of Leaking Pipe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Centerville, GA. Our team will work with you to create a customized plan and provide a free estimate for the work.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water, the size of the affected area, and the complexity of the job.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the level of moisture, and the number of equipment required. |
| Repair and rest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age, the materials required, and the complexity of the repair. |
| Final inspection and clean-up |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of detail required. |
